这是TensorFlow Lite的实验端口,针对微控制器和其他只有千字节内存的设备。它不需要任何操作系统支持,任何标准的C或C ++库或动态内存分配,因此它的设计甚至可以移植到“裸机”系统。核心运行时在Cortex M3上适合16KB,并且有足够的运算符来运行语音关键字检测模型,总共占用22KB。
项目GitHub网站:https://github.com/tensorflow/tensorflow/tree/master/tensorflow/lite/experimental/micro
如需更多文档,请点击此处:https://www.tensorflow.org/lite/guide/microcontroller
如果想要自定义示例,可以试用此代码实验室:https://g.co/codelabs/sparkfunTF
可以使用Google提供的这个教程训练自己的模型。它拥有一个开放数据集,其中包含 100000 多条志愿者提交的语音,欢迎小伙伴们通过链接帮助扩展此数据集:https://aiyprojects.withgoogle.com/open_speech_recording